JAMMU: Career Abacus, a leading Abacus teaching Institute, concluded 15-day robotic workshop called ‘Roboshala’ for the children of 7 to 15 years of age.
Children from different schools participated in the workshop and learned how to make Robots and programme them.
During the workshop teacher explained the concept to the students and the students started by exploring the Robotic kit, assembling various components by following the instructions and giving shape to the robot.
The overall programme helps the student visually grasp the concepts of Math and Science thereby enhancing the problem solving skills.
Director of Institute, Arvind Sharma informed, “We aim to introduce the concept of Educational Robotics in schools as Robotics is the future tool for learning methodology.”
The purpose of Educational Robotics, he said, is to provide the students with a platform where they can experience the most critical concepts in education.
